Stealth-Roughnecks' Playoff Showdown

April 13, 2017 - National Lacrosse League (NLL)
Vancouver Stealth News Release


Vancouver, BC - The Vancouver Stealth (6-9) host the Calgary Roughnecks (7-9) in one of the most pivotal games of the season.

With last weekend's win, the Roughnecks temporarily leapfrogged the Stealth for the third and final playoff position in the West. Calgary is currently riding a three-game winning streak knocking off New England, Rochester and Buffalo. Curtis Dickson has played a major role in the surge for the Roughnecks. Dickson bumped Corey Small for the league's lead with 46 goals, 50 assists and 96 points in 16 games.

"This is going to be a battle. This game has serious playoff implications for both teams," said Stealth Captain Curtis Hodgson. "To get the result we are looking for, we need a full team effort and we need to grind to take this opportunity."

With three games left in the 2017 regular season, the Stealth are focusing on a playoff berth. Vancouver's scenarios for the playoff push are a plenty right now, including winning the final three games, winning a pair but losing to Calgary and several others. Regardless of the potential paths the Stealth can take, one thing is clear, Vancouver will rely on Tye Belanger in net. He has started the last 10 games, has an 11.37 goals against average and heading into Week 16 sits second in the league with a .787 save percentage.

"The team is excited and very hungry for a playoff position and this is obviously a crucial game," said transition player Justin Salt. "It is a big game not only in the standings but also because we are expecting a great crowd and we can't wait to hear them cheering us on. I think making the playoffs would be excellent for the city and the province."

Saturday's game is "Lacrosse on the Move night" where any youth wearing a minor lacrosse jersey gets inside the Langley Events Centre for free with a paying adult. The Stealth will also be wearing special British Columbia-themed jerseys. The jerseys will be auctioned off at the end of the game. All proceeds will go to the Lacrosse on the Move Fund for BC Lacrosse.
